Line of Effort¶
Structure a campaign around a condition to be created rather than terrain by laying out parallel rails of task → effect → effect → end state, each an auditable causal chain coupled to the others only at named handoff points.
Core Idea¶
A line of effort (LOE) is a US joint-doctrine planning device in operational design that organises tasks, intermediate effects, and end states along a logical axis where geographic continuity is absent or inadequate — tying actions not to terrain but to a condition to be created. Where a line of operation structures a campaign around spatial geometry, a line of effort structures it around a causal-conditional chain: each node on the rail is an observable intermediate effect that upstream tasks are expected to produce and that downstream tasks require as a precondition, running from first task to end state along a labelled workstream (e.g., "restore essential services," "establish legitimate governance," "neutralise the threat network").
In practice a campaign plan is depicted as several parallel LOEs, each a sequenced rail of task → effect → effect → end state, and the planning staff's primary synchronisation work is localised to the cross-rail handoff points where one rail's intermediate effect is another rail's required precondition. Codified in US joint doctrine (JP 5-0, ADP 5-0) and used in coalition campaign planning (NATO COPD, UK JDP 5-00), LOEs became the central depiction device in counterinsurgency and stabilisation operations — most prominently in FM 3-24 — precisely because those campaigns are structured around non-kinetic, non-geographic, effect-defined objectives in which the traditional line of operation cannot carry the planning load. The construct disciplines planners to make the implicit causal model explicit: a vague theme such as "improve governance" must be restated as a chain of named, measurable intermediate effects, exposing every unjustified assumption between tasks and end state.

What It Is Not¶
- Not a schedule of when tasks run. A populated milestone schedule or synch matrix depicts what runs when; a line of effort depicts what causes what en route to a condition. A campaign can be perfectly sequenced in time and still have no defensible account of how its tasks add up to the end state — "on time and going nowhere." The two are complementary depictions, not the same one rebadged.
- Not a guarantee that the campaign is coherently designed. Drawing the rails does not make the design sound; it only makes the design inspectable. A fully staffed set of LOEs whose intermediate effects are unmeasurable is a slogan with arrows — effort asserted toward an end state with no mechanism between them. Coherence is what the audit of each rail and each handoff is supposed to establish, not what the depiction confers by existing.
- Not a theme or heading. "Improve governance" is a label; a line of effort is the falsifiable chain that label must be restated as — "provincial elections held → district councils operating → budget execution reaching service-delivery units → public satisfaction rising." Every node must be an observable effect attributable to its upstream tasks, or it is not a legitimate rail node at all.
- Not organised by terrain. The construct's defining commitment is non-geographic: rails are oriented to a condition to be created, not to ground to be taken. Treating an LOE as a path across the map collapses it into its doctrinal sibling, the line of operation; the LOE exists precisely for campaigns where geographic continuity is absent or inadequate and cannot carry the planning load.
- Not a claim that synchronising the whole task matrix is the job. In principle every task could couple to every other, but only the named cross-rail handoff points are first-class dependencies. The device's whole economy is to localise scarce coordination attention to those few points, not to coordinate the entire N-by-N field.

Scope of Application¶
The line of effort lives across the operational-design and campaign-planning subfields of military strategic studies; its reach is within that planning domain, and where the parallel-rail picture shows up in civilian programmes it is the parent pattern travelling (see Knowledge Transfer), not the doctrinal construct.
- US joint operational design (JP 5-0, ADP 5-0) — the canonical home; LOEs structure stability operations, humanitarian assistance, and counterinsurgency around security, governance, essential-services, economic, and information rails.
- Counterinsurgency and stabilisation (FM 3-24) — the campaigns the device was built for, where geographic decisive points are weak and most of the work is effect-defined work in populations and institutions, so the LOE is simply applied rather than adapted.
- Coalition campaign planning (NATO COPD, UK JDP 5-00) — the same effect-chained rail under different doctrinal wording; an allied planner audits the identical artifact of named, measurable effects and satisfied handoffs.
- Humanitarian-assistance and disaster-response planning — parallel rails (essential services, security, governance, strategic communication) toward a relief end state, with cross-rail handoffs as the coordination focus.
- Inter-agency / whole-of-government campaign planning — multi-department plans in which State, USAID, and DHS each own a rail crossing departmental authorities toward a shared political end state.

Manages Complexity¶
A campaign whose objectives are non-geographic and effect-defined — restore essential services, establish legitimate governance, neutralise a threat network, all unfolding at once across populations, institutions, and infrastructure — presents the planning staff with a sprawl that resists ordinary military depiction: dozens of heterogeneous tasks, scores of conditions to be created, and a dense thicket of dependencies among them, none of which lie on a map and most of which interact. Tracked task-by-task or as one undifferentiated theatre matrix, the design is unreadable; no officer can hold the whole of "improve governance plus secure the population plus rebuild the economy plus shape perceptions" in view, let alone audit whether the effort actually converts into the desired end state. The line of effort compresses this by factoring the campaign into a small number of parallel rails — typically four to six — each a single readable story of the form task → effect → effect → end state. The full design collapses from an N-by-N web of interacting tasks into a handful of sequential chains plus the much smaller set of cross-rail handoff points where one rail's intermediate effect is another rail's required precondition.
The compression has two distinct moves. First, within a rail the planner need not hold the whole campaign in mind, only a local causal claim: does this task produce its named intermediate effect, and is that effect the precondition the next task needs? The rail becomes a falsifiable chain the staff can walk node by node, each node measurable and attributable to its upstream tasks. Second, across rails the synchronisation problem — in principle every task potentially coupled to every other — is reduced to the handful of explicitly identified handoff points; the staff's hardest, scarcest attention is directed there rather than spread uniformly over the matrix. What the planner reads off the depiction is the campaign's load-bearing logic made inspectable: trace each rail to confirm its causal chain holds, and check each handoff to confirm the supplying rail is delivering the effect the receiving rail consumes. A rail whose intermediate effects are unmeasurable shows up immediately as a slogan with arrows — effort asserted toward an end state with no mechanism between them — and a campaign whose handoffs are failing shows up as a downstream rail starved of its preconditions even while its own tasks proceed on schedule.
The parameters the planner tracks are thus few and standing: the number of rails, the named intermediate effects on each, the measurability of each effect, and the set of cross-rail dependencies — supplemented by the dominant rail of each phase, since the leading workstream characteristically pivots across the campaign (security-led early, governance-led mid, economic-led late) and the depiction externalises that shift. From these the staff reads off the qualitative health of the design without re-deriving the entire task ecology: a coherent set of rails with measurable effects and satisfied handoffs is a defensible campaign; a fully populated schedule sitting atop rails that are bare themes is a campaign that is on time and going nowhere. The move is from a high-dimensional, interaction-dense task field to a small bundle of auditable causal chains coupled at a few named points.

Examples¶
Canonical¶
The counterinsurgency campaign design codified in FM 3-24 is the defining instance. A stabilisation plan is drawn as several parallel lines of effort — security, governance, essential services, economic development, information — each a rail of task → effect → effect → end state. The essential-services rail, for example, restated out of the theme "improve daily life," reads: repair water and power → utilities functioning in the district → markets reopen and commerce resumes → population cooperation with authorities rises. Crucially, that rail cannot run alone: its early nodes depend on the security rail having cleared and held the district, a cross-rail dependency the planners mark explicitly. The doctrine forces each node to be an observable, attributable effect, so a rail that is only a slogan is exposed as such.
Mapped back: A stable, legitimately governed district is the end state; security, governance, and essential-services workstreams are the parallel rails. "Utilities functioning," "markets reopen," "cooperation rises" are the intermediate effects, each subject to the measurability admissibility condition. That the services rail needs the security rail's "district secured" is a cross-rail handoff point. Organising by conditions-to-be-created in a population rather than terrain is the non-geographic frame the LOE exists for.
Applied / In Practice¶
The 2007 Iraq "surge" campaign plan (the Joint Campaign Plan developed under General Petraeus and Ambassador Crocker) was structured as coordinated lines of effort spanning military and civilian agencies — security, governance/political reconciliation, economic development and essential services, rule of law, and building Iraqi security forces. The design made explicit that political and economic progress was gated on the security rail: population security had to be established in a neighbourhood before governance and reconstruction efforts could take hold there. Synchronisation attention concentrated where the security rail handed off "area secured" to the governance and services rails, and the plan's coherence was judged by whether those handoffs were actually being met rather than by whether tasks were merely on schedule.
Mapped back: A stable, self-sustaining Iraqi state is the end state; the security, governance, economic, and force-generation workstreams are the parallel rails, each crossing agency authorities. "Population security established" functioning as the precondition for governance and reconstruction is the cross-rail handoff point onto which scarce coordination attention was localised. Judging coherence by satisfied handoffs rather than schedule completion is the audit the intermediate effects and their measurability condition enforce.
Structural Tensions¶
T1: Inspectable versus coherent (the depiction exposes the design but does not make it sound). The line of effort's value is that it forces a campaign's implicit causal model into view — a vague theme must be restated as a chain of named, measurable effects, so unjustified assumptions become visible. But drawing the rails confers nothing on the design itself; it only makes the design auditable. A fully staffed set of LOEs whose intermediate effects are unmeasurable is a slogan with arrows — effort asserted toward an end state with no mechanism between them — that looks like rigorous planning precisely because it has the rail grammar. The tension is that the artifact which is supposed to expose incoherence can, when populated without discipline, disguise it: the more professional the depiction, the more it can be mistaken for the coherence it merely enables. Diagnostic: Does each node name an observable effect attributable to its upstream task, or does the rail have the shape of an audited chain while its effects are unmeasurable assertions?
T2: Logical workstream versus temporal schedule (on time and going nowhere). The LOE depicts what causes what en route to a condition; a Gantt chart or synch matrix depicts what runs when. These are complementary, but the availability of a fully populated milestone schedule creates a standing temptation to read scheduling completeness as design coherence — a plan can be perfectly sequenced in time and still have no defensible account of how its tasks add up to the end state. The tension is that the temporal artifact is more familiar, more concrete, and more readily completed than the causal one, so a staff under pressure gravitates to the schedule and mistakes a campaign that is "on time and going nowhere" for one that is on track. The two depictions answer different questions and neither substitutes for the other. Diagnostic: Is progress being judged by whether tasks are running on schedule, or by whether each rail's causal chain actually converts effort into the named end state?
T3: Rail decomposition versus cross-rail coupling (the economy that assumes the rest of the web is negligible). Factoring a campaign into a few parallel rails collapses an N-by-N web of interacting tasks into a handful of readable chains plus a small set of named handoff points, and that reduction is the whole source of the device's tractability — scarce synchronisation attention goes to the few first-class dependencies rather than the whole matrix. But the reduction is a bet that the couplings not named at handoffs are negligible, and real campaigns generate emergent dependencies the initial decomposition did not foresee: a security action that undermines governance legitimacy, an economic rail that feeds the threat network. The tension is that the parallel-rail simplification buys readability by declaring most of the interaction structure out of scope, and a coupling that matters but was never marked as a handoff is exactly what the device is built not to see. Diagnostic: Are the only cross-rail dependencies in play the named handoffs, or are there emergent couplings between rails that the parallel-rail decomposition has rendered invisible?
T4: The measurability gate versus the important-but-unmeasurable (disciplining rails by excluding what cannot be counted). The admissibility condition — every node an observable, attributable effect — is what turns a rail from a theme into a falsifiable hypothesis, and it rightly exposes an unstaffable rail as a slogan. But the gate cuts both ways: some genuinely load-bearing intermediate conditions in stabilisation campaigns — legitimacy, trust, popular will, perceived security — resist clean measurement and attribution, and a strict measurability requirement biases the campaign's articulated logic toward what can be counted (patrols run, kilowatts restored) over what actually converts effort into the end state. The tension is that the discipline which prunes slogans also risks pruning the real but unmeasurable effects, so a campaign can be fully auditable and still have designed around its hardest, most decisive conditions. Diagnostic: Are the measurable nodes on this rail the ones that genuinely drive the end state, or has the measurability gate substituted countable proxies for the decisive but unmeasurable conditions?

Not to Be Confused With¶
-
Line of operation. The doctrinal twin the line of effort is explicitly defined against: it structures a campaign by spatial geometry — terrain, decisive points, geographic objectives — where the line of effort structures it by a condition to be created along a logical, non-geographic axis. They are complementary depictions for different campaign types. Tell: is the campaign organized around ground to be taken (line of operation) or effects to be produced where terrain is absent or inadequate (line of effort)? Treating an LOE as a path across the map collapses it into its sibling.
-
Milestone schedule / synchronization matrix (Gantt chart). A depiction of what runs when — tasks sequenced in time. A line of effort depicts what causes what en route to a condition. A campaign can be perfectly scheduled and still have no defensible causal account of how tasks reach the end state ("on time and going nowhere"). Tell: does the artifact show tasks against a timeline (schedule), or tasks producing intermediate effects that gate downstream tasks (line of effort)? Complementary, not interchangeable.
-
Logic model / theory of change. The development-evaluation family's chain — input → output → outcome → impact — the LOE's civilian cousin with the same causal-chain shape. But it lacks the LOE's non-geographic-frame-against-line-of-operation, its doctrinally-mandated measurability, and its phasing pivot; it is a co-instance of the shared parent pattern, not the doctrinal construct. Tell: is the chain a program-evaluation logic model (input-to-impact, no terrain contrast, no joint-doctrine apparatus), or a military line of effort (effect-defined, measurability-gated, defined against the line of operation)?
-
Campaign theme / heading. A label like "improve governance" — a slogan naming an aspiration. A line of effort is the falsifiable causal chain that label must be restated as ("elections held → councils operating → budgets executed → satisfaction rising"), every node an observable effect attributable to upstream tasks. Tell: is it a heading naming a goal (theme), or a sequence of measurable, attributable intermediate effects with a mechanism between task and end state (line of effort)? A rail of bare themes is "a slogan with arrows."
